Muriate of Potash (0-0-60) vs Sulfate of Potash (0-0-50): Compared
Muriate of potash is cheaper and works well for most crops and lawns. Sulfate of potash is essential for chloride-sensitive crops like berries, tobacco, potatoes, and fruit trees, and adds beneficial sulfur to the soil.

| Factor | Muriate of Potash (0-0-60) | Sulfate of Potash (0-0-50) |
|---|---|---|
Cost Muriate of potash costs roughly half as much as sulfate of potash per pound of potassium | ||
Chloride-Sensitive Crops Muriate contains 47% chloride which damages berries, tobacco, and some fruit trees. Sulfate is chloride-free | ||
Sulfur Content Sulfate of potash provides 18% sulfur, an important secondary nutrient for crop quality | ||
General Lawn Use Turfgrass is chloride-tolerant, and the lower cost makes muriate the standard for lawn potassium | ||
Soil Salinity Sulfate of potash has a much lower salt index, making it safer for saline soils and greenhouse use |
